In New York City, premises liability laws play a crucial role in ensuring safety for visitors and residents. A Premises Liability Lawyer NYC specializes in cases where individuals suffer injuries or deaths due to unsafe conditions on someone else’s property. These laws hold property owners, landlords, and managers accountable for maintaining their premises in a safe condition. The legal framework involves proving that the defendant had actual or constructive knowledge of a dangerous situation and failed to take reasonable measures to address it.
When navigating premises liability claims in NYC, several key elements come into play. Plaintiffs must demonstrate that they were injured on the property due to a hazardous condition, and that the property owner was negligent in addressing or preventing the hazard. The city’s unique landscape, with its bustling streets and diverse real estate, requires careful consideration of these factors. Property owners have a duty to foresee potential risks and take proactive steps to ensure the safety of visitors, which forms the backbone of premises liability cases in New York City.
– Definition and scope of premises liability
Premises liability refers to a legal concept where property owners or managers are held responsible for any harm or injury that occurs on their premises. This includes situations where individuals slip and fall, trip over obstacles, or encounter dangerous conditions that lead to accidents. The scope of premises liability encompasses a wide range of situations. It applies to various types of properties, from commercial buildings and malls to residential apartments and public parks. Legal standards require property owners to maintain their premises in a safe condition, regularly inspect for potential hazards, and promptly address any known risks. Failure to do so can result in legal liability if visitors or customers sustain injuries due to these hazardous conditions.
